Home Organization: A Paper Read, by Request, at A Conference of Clerical and Lay Members and Friends of the Society for the Propagation of the Gospel

"Home Organization: A Paper Read..." by H.W. Tucker offers a glimpse into late 19th-century perspectives on domestic management within a religious context. Originally presented at a conference of the Society for the Propagation of the Gospel in Foreign Parts in 1880, this essay explores the importance of order and efficiency in the home. While reflecting the social norms and values of its time, the text provides insights into the roles and responsibilities associated with maintaining a household and fostering a Christian environment within the family. This historical document provides context into the domestic expectations of the Victorian era.
